Origin of the Name Farook

The name Farook comes from the Arabic root letters 'f-r-q', which means to distinguish or separate. The root word 'farq' means difference or distinction. In Classical Arabic, the word 'farq' was used to describe something that is distinct or separate from others. In Early Islamic history, the name Farook was used to describe someone who could distinguish right from wrong.
